OUR TOWN

Coming Soon!!!

Get your tickets early for our production of Thornton Wilder's OUR TOWN. Under the direction of Allen Schmeltz and starring Sam Williams as the Stage Manager and Hannah Hurst as Emily Webb along with many other talented actors, this production is staged and performed in the way that Thornton Wilder wanted, with a minimal set and the miming of many props. In doing so the meaning of the play is enhanced and becomes very strong. The great playwright, Edward Albee, said OUR TOWN was "...the greatest American play ever written."

FLEX PASSES

Flex Passes

Flex Passes are a great way to save money on individual tickets and create your own personalized season. We offer Flex Pass packages of different sizes (see below). Simply call ahead to book seats and show the Flex Pass at the door when you arrive. Choose from either the Off-Broadway Series or the Family Series. (Off Broadway Flex Passes may be used for Family Series productions, but not vice versa.) Flex Passes can now be bought online as well as in person and over the phone. Click Here to purchase your Flex Passes on-line.

MUSICAL THEATRE with Christine Irish

Wednesdays - 5:00pm - 6:30pm

Ages 12 - 18 yrs old

Fee: $70 a month (Drop-in fee $25 per class)


This class is all about being an actor who sings and moves! On stage, every movement has motivation and sometimes you have to come up with a reason why you walk somewhere or why you sing or say something. In this class, each student will learn what it truly means to be an actor. Everything learned can be applied to being in a musical, performing a solo, or even preparing for a monologue. Participants will play theatre games, block and perform numbers from various musicals, prepare solos, work on cold readings, and hone their audition technique. Participants will learn how to make their performance come to life. If you love to sing, act, and perform then this is the class for you!

CHILDREN'S INTRODUCTION TO THEATRE with Lindy Mallonee

 

Bright Stars A Class (Resuming January 9)

Ages: 6-8

When: Thursdays 4:00-5:00pm

Tuition: $70 a month (Drop-in fee $25 per class)

 

Bright Stars B Class (Resuming January 9)

Ages: 9-12

When: Thursdays 5:30-6:30pm

Tuition: $70 a month (Drop-in fee $25 per class)

 

Our Bright Stars classes are for our group of aspiring actors, offering basic theatre skills to first time as well as continuing students. We will cover acting techniques while having fun through drama activities, role-playing, games, stage movement, music, vocal projection, crafts, costuming and peer interaction. We will offer opportunities for family and friends to attend performances at times throughout each session.


Lindy has many years experience working with young people in performing and visual arts.
